European jewelers use the Metric system for marking gold items. 585 is used to mark 14K. 14K is 58.5% Gold.
US $20 gold coins are made of 90% gold, which puts it at about 21 1/2 kt.

Yes, 14 kt (karat) gold is considered to be of higher purity than 10 kt gold. Specifically, 14 kt gold contains 58.3% pure gold, while 10 kt gold contains only 41.7% pure gold. Therefore, 14 kt gold is more valuable and has a richer gold color compared to 10 kt gold.

Pure gold is 24 kt. 14 kt gold is (14/24)=.5833 pure. Multiply by 100 and it is 58.33% pure.
